The solutions of the wave equation for a membrane bounded by fixed two eccentric circles are obtained. By the aid of the addition theorem of the Bessel functions, the boundary condition on two circles is reduced to a set of homogeneous simultaneous linear equations, from which eigenvalues and eigenfunctions are obtained in power series of d (the distance between two centers). Some numerical results are obtained to the order of d6 or d4.
